How to Bulk Safely as a Teenager

Bulking is an intentional strategy combining a calorie surplus with resistance training to maximize muscle growth. For teenagers, this process is unique because the body is still growing and developing rapidly, requiring a highly cautious approach. The goal is to gain lean muscle mass while minimizing unnecessary fat accumulation, which relies heavily on precision in nutrition and training. The high metabolism often seen in teenagers can make consuming enough calories challenging, but the body is generally efficient at utilizing nutrients for growth.

Fueling Growth: The Teenage Bulking Diet

The foundation of safe bulking for a teenager is the creation of a moderate caloric surplus. Instead of eating everything in sight, which leads to excessive fat gain often called a “dirty bulk,” aim for a clean bulk by consuming approximately 250 to 500 calories above your maintenance level. This measured approach helps ensure the extra energy is channeled primarily into muscle tissue synthesis rather than fat reserves.

Macronutrients must be strategically balanced to support the demanding needs of muscle growth and high activity levels. Protein is the most important macronutrient for muscle repair and growth. Aim for a high protein intake, roughly 30 to 35% of total daily calories, or about 1.6 to 2.2 grams per kilogram of body weight. This level of protein intake supports the constant repair of muscle fibers broken down during intense training.

Carbohydrates should make up the largest portion of the diet, typically 40 to 50% of total calories, as they are the primary fuel source for high-intensity resistance workouts. Complex carbohydrates, such as oats, brown rice, and sweet potatoes, provide sustained energy, helping to replenish muscle glycogen stores efficiently after a workout. Healthy fats, which should account for 20 to 30% of daily calories, are important for hormone production, including testosterone, which is a significant factor in muscle development.

Choosing nutrient-dense, whole foods over processed items is a defining factor in a clean bulk. Examples include:

  • Lean meats
  • Eggs
  • Greek yogurt
  • Nuts
  • Avocados
  • Whole grains

Consuming frequent, balanced meals—perhaps five or six smaller meals throughout the day—can make hitting the necessary calorie and protein targets more manageable without feeling overly full. This consistent nutrient delivery helps maintain energy levels throughout the day to support an active lifestyle and training schedule.

Training Safely for Hypertrophy

Resistance training must be approached with a primary focus on safety and proper mechanics before increasing any load. The principle of progressive overload is the mechanism for muscle hypertrophy, requiring the muscle to be continually challenged beyond its current capacity to stimulate growth. This means gradually increasing the demand over time, not simply lifting heavier weight every session.

Progressive overload can be applied by:

  • Increasing the weight
  • Performing more repetitions
  • Performing more sets
  • Slightly decreasing the rest time between sets

When starting, the initial focus must be on mastering the movement patterns of an exercise with minimal or no weight. Only once proper form is consistently maintained across all repetitions should the resistance be slowly increased.

A training frequency of 3 to 4 times per week is appropriate for teenagers, allowing for adequate recovery time between sessions. The workout program should prioritize compound movements, which engage multiple joints and muscle groups simultaneously, leading to greater overall muscle stimulation. Highly effective compound movements that build foundational strength and muscle mass include:

  • Squats
  • Deadlifts
  • Overhead presses
  • Rows

The intensity of lifting should be monitored closely; if form begins to break down during a set, the weight is too heavy and must be reduced immediately. The goal of each set is quality repetitions that challenge the muscle, not lifting the absolute maximum weight possible. Utilizing submaximal loads, or weights less than your one-repetition maximum, is the safest and most effective way to drive muscle growth while protecting the developing joints and muscles.

Navigating Developmental Stages and Safety

Bulking during adolescence requires consideration of unique physiological factors, particularly the status of the growth plates. These are areas of developing cartilage near the ends of long bones where bone growth occurs. While resistance training itself does not stunt growth, excessive and uncontrolled heavy lifting carries a risk of injury to these growth plates.

The concern is not with moderate-intensity strength training, which is safe and beneficial for bone health, but rather with attempts to perform one-repetition maximum (1RM) lifts. Maxing out on weight should be avoided until skeletal maturity is confirmed, as the growth plates are relatively weaker than the surrounding bone and are more susceptible to injury from extreme forces. Hormonal changes during puberty, especially the surge in testosterone for males, naturally enhance the ability to build muscle.

The use of supplements and performance-enhancing substances must be approached with extreme caution. Teenagers should avoid anabolic steroids or other performance-enhancing drugs, as these can disrupt the body’s natural hormonal balance and cause serious long-term health risks. Common supplements like protein powder can be a convenient way to meet high protein needs, but whole food sources are always preferred.

Creatine monohydrate is one of the most studied supplements, but its use, along with pre-workout formulas that often contain high levels of stimulants, should only be considered after consulting with a physician or registered dietitian. Prioritizing a well-rounded diet and safe training practices is the most effective path to muscle gain.

Prioritizing Sleep and Recovery

Muscle growth occurs during the rest and recovery period, not the workout itself. Sleep is the most powerful component of recovery, serving as the time when the body initiates its primary repair processes. During deep sleep stages, the pituitary gland releases a significant amount of growth hormone, which stimulates muscle tissue repair and growth.

For teenagers, who are undergoing both physical development and intense training, aiming for 8 to 10 hours of quality sleep per night is highly recommended. Insufficient sleep can elevate levels of the stress hormone cortisol, which can hinder muscle growth and promote muscle breakdown. A consistent sleep schedule, going to bed and waking up around the same time each day, helps regulate the body’s natural sleep-wake cycle and optimizes the timing of growth hormone release.

Active recovery, which includes light activity like walking or gentle stretching on non-training days, can also aid in muscle recovery by promoting blood flow and reducing muscle soreness. Managing overall stress, both physical and mental, is also a part of the recovery process. Providing the body with sufficient rest ensures that the effort put into nutrition and training is fully utilized for building muscle.
